Level 1 - Dosage Calculation Practice Problems.
JD Learning Lab
1. A physician orders gr 1/6 of morphine. Drug is available in 15mg/cc. Give: (ans: 0.67cc)
2. Prepare 0.8 mg of atropine sulfate from a vial containing 0.6mg/cc. Give: (ans 1.33 ml)
3. A patient is to receive 0.25 GM of absorbic acid from a container labeled 500 mg in 2 ml. Give: (ans 1.00 ml)
4. A vial of penicillin solution contains 400,000 U/ml. You are to give 500,000 U. Give: (ans 1.25 ml)
5. Prepare codeine sulfate gr. 2/3 from an ampule labeled codeine sulfate 60mg/cc. Give: (ans 0.67 cc)
6. A patient is to receive gr 3/4 of phenergan. Phhenergan is available in 25mg/ml. Give: (ans 1.80 ml)
7. A physician ordered 1,500,000 units of penicillin labeled 5,000,000 units/cc. Give: (ans 0.30 cc)
8. 8,000 units of heparin is ordered. Dosage on hand is 10,000 units per 1 cc. Give: (ans 0.80 cc)
9. Thiamine hydrochloride is available in 15 mg tablets. You are to give gr 1/2. Give: (ans 2 tab)
10. Crystodigin from an ampule labeled 0.2 mg in 1 ml. Prepare 0.15 mg. Give: (ans .75 ml)
11. Lanoxin 0.1 mg tablets are available. Give gr 1/300. Give: (ans 2 tabs)
12. Ferrous sulfate 0.2 GM tablets are available. Give gr vi qid. How many tablets for each dose? How many tablets for a 24 hour period? (2 tabs per dose, and 8 tabs in 24 hours)
13. Phenobarb 15 mg is ordered, you have on hand phenobarb 20 mg/5 cc. Give: (ans 3.75 cc)
14. Kantrex 75 mg is ordered, you have on hand kantrex 0.5 GM in 2 ml. Give: (ans 0.30 cc)
15. Atropine gr 1/450 is ordered, you have on hand atropine 0.4 mg/cc Give: (ans 0.33 cc)
16. Penicillin 75,000 U is ordered, you have on hand penicillin 600,000 units/cc. Give: (ans 0.13 cc)
17. A bottle contains gr 1 1/4 tablets of asprin. How many tablets are needed to give 150 mg? (ans 2 tabs)
18. Ordered is mandol 600 mg IM, you have on hand Mandol 1 GM which mixes up to give 225 mg/cc. Calculate the dosage: (ans 2.67 cc)
19. Morphine gr 1/12 is ordered. On hand is morphine sulphate 15mg/cc. Give:(ans 0.33 cc)
